James George Barbour was born in 1850 in Harvey, Albert, New Brunswick, the child of William Barbour And Jessie Crosby. In 1852, James George Barbour resided in Harvey, Albert, New Brunswick, Canada. James George Barbour married Lydia Ann Oliver, and had children including Alva Barbour, Flavilla C Barbour, James Harley Barbour, Lauretta B Barbour, Otty Ludwig Barbour, Winnifred Edna Barbour. James George Barbour passed away in 1927 in Waterside, Albert, New Brunswick, Canada.
